如何在 PHP 中动态引入和使用 JavaScript 文件214
在 PHP web 开发中,经常需要在网页中引入 JavaScript 文件以添加交互性和高级功能。本文将深入探讨如何在 PHP 中动态引入 JavaScript 文件,并提供实际示例来阐明该过程。
引入 JavaScript 文件
要将 JavaScript 文件引入 PHP 脚本,可以使用 script 标签。以下示例演示了如何在 文件中引入 文件:```php
```
您也可以使用 PHP 的 header() 函数来添加 script 标签。这允许您动态控制 JavaScript 文件的引入:```php
```
动态引入 JavaScript 文件
某些情况下,您可能需要根据特定条件或用户交互动态引入 JavaScript 文件。PHP 提供了以下方法来实现这一点:
include() 函数:将 JavaScript 文件的内容直接包含到 PHP 脚本中。
file_get_contents() 函数:读取 JavaScript 文件的内容,并将其作为字符串返回。
fopen() 和 fwrite() 函数:打开 JavaScript 文件并将其内容写入到另一个文件或流中。
以下示例展示了如何使用 include() 函数动态引入 JavaScript 文件:```php
```
使用引入的 JavaScript 文件
一旦 JavaScript 文件被引入到 PHP 脚本中,您就可以在网页中使用它。这可以通过以下方式实现:
全局变量:JavaScript 文件中定义的全局变量可以由 PHP 脚本访问。
函数调用:JavaScript 文件中定义的函数可以通过 PHP 脚本调用。
事件处理程序:JavaScript 文件中定义的事件处理程序可以通过 PHP 脚本添加或删除。
以下示例展示了如何使用引入的 JavaScript 文件中的全局变量:```php
```
最佳实践
在 PHP 中引入 JavaScript 文件时,请遵循以下最佳实践:
遵循 JavaScript 文件命名约定(例如 .js 扩展名)。
使用内容分发网络 (CDN) 托管 JavaScript 文件以提高性能。
仅在需要时引入 JavaScript 文件,以避免不必要的加载时间。
考虑使用工具(如 Grunt 或 Gulp)来管理和自动化 JavaScript 文件的引入。
在 PHP 中动态引入 JavaScript 文件是一个强大的功能,它允许您添加交互性和高级功能到您的网页。通过理解本文中介绍的技术,您可以有效地在 PHP 应用程序中使用 JavaScript 文件,从而增强用户体验并构建强大的 web 应用程序。
2024-11-04
Python高效查询与处理表格数据:从Excel到CSV的实战指南
https://www.shuihudhg.cn/134472.html
Java字符编码终极指南:告别乱码,驾驭全球字符集
https://www.shuihudhg.cn/134471.html
PHP高效解析图片EXIF数据:从基础到实践
https://www.shuihudhg.cn/134470.html
深入C语言:用结构体与函数指针构建面向对象(OOP)模型
https://www.shuihudhg.cn/134469.html
Python Turtle绘制可爱小猪:从零开始的代码艺术之旅
https://www.shuihudhg.cn/134468.html
热门文章
在 PHP 中有效获取关键词
https://www.shuihudhg.cn/19217.html
PHP 对象转换成数组的全面指南
https://www.shuihudhg.cn/75.html
PHP如何获取图片后缀
https://www.shuihudhg.cn/3070.html
将 PHP 字符串转换为整数
https://www.shuihudhg.cn/2852.html
PHP 连接数据库字符串:轻松建立数据库连接
https://www.shuihudhg.cn/1267.html